数据库疑问是什么意思啊
-
数据库疑问是指在使用数据库时出现的问题或困惑。数据库是用来存储和管理数据的系统,常用于各种应用程序中。在使用数据库时,用户可能会遇到一些技术或操作上的问题,需要解决这些问题才能顺利地使用数据库。以下是关于数据库疑问的一些常见问题和解答:
-
数据库连接问题:在使用数据库时,可能会遇到连接数据库的问题。例如,无法连接到数据库、连接超时、连接断开等。解决这些问题需要检查数据库服务器的配置,网络连接是否正常,以及数据库连接字符串等。
-
数据库性能问题:数据库性能是使用数据库时的关键问题之一。当数据库变慢或响应时间增加时,用户可能会遇到性能问题。这可能是由于数据库服务器负载过高、查询语句不优化、索引缺失等原因引起的。解决数据库性能问题需要进行性能分析和优化,例如优化查询语句、创建索引、调整数据库参数等。
-
数据库安全问题:数据库安全是保护数据免受未经授权访问和恶意攻击的重要问题。用户可能会遇到数据库被入侵、数据泄露、权限不当等安全问题。为了解决数据库安全问题,需要采取一系列措施,如使用强密码、限制数据库访问权限、定期备份和恢复数据等。
-
数据库备份和恢复问题:在使用数据库时,用户需要定期备份数据以防止数据丢失。当数据发生故障或错误时,用户可能需要恢复数据库。备份和恢复数据库需要选择合适的备份策略和工具,并且确保备份的完整性和可靠性。
-
数据库查询和操作问题:在使用数据库时,用户可能会遇到查询和操作数据的问题。例如,查询语句无法返回正确的结果、更新操作没有生效等。解决这些问题需要检查查询语句的正确性、数据的完整性和一致性,以及数据库操作的权限等。
总之,数据库疑问是指在使用数据库时遇到的问题或困惑,需要解决这些问题才能顺利地使用数据库。这些问题可能涉及数据库连接、性能、安全、备份恢复以及查询和操作等方面。解决这些问题需要掌握数据库的相关知识和技术,并采取相应的措施和方法来解决。
1年前 -
-
数据库疑问是指在数据库设计、开发、维护和使用过程中出现的问题或困惑。数据库是用于存储和管理数据的系统,它在各个领域中广泛应用,包括企业管理、科学研究、电子商务等。在使用数据库的过程中,可能会遇到各种各样的问题,例如数据丢失、性能问题、安全性问题、查询优化等。这些问题可能会影响到数据库的正常运行和数据的完整性、一致性和可用性。因此,解决数据库疑问是数据库管理员和开发人员的重要任务之一。要解决数据库疑问,需要对数据库的原理和技术有一定的了解,并且具备问题解决的能力和经验。数据库疑问可能涉及到数据库的结构设计、数据模型选择、索引设计、查询优化、事务管理、备份恢复、安全性管理等方面的问题。解决数据库疑问需要综合考虑数据库的需求、约束条件和实际情况,采取合适的策略和方法来解决问题。通过解决数据库疑问,可以提高数据库的性能、安全性和可靠性,提高系统的效率和用户的满意度。
1年前 -
数据库疑问是指在使用数据库时遇到的问题或困惑。数据库是存储和管理数据的系统,常用于存储和操作大量数据的应用程序。在使用数据库的过程中,可能会遇到各种各样的问题,例如数据丢失、性能问题、查询优化等。解决这些问题需要了解数据库的基本原理和技术,并且运用相应的方法和工具进行排查和修复。
下面将从方法和操作流程等方面详细讲解如何解决数据库疑问。
一、问题排查方法:
-
确定问题:首先要明确问题是什么,例如数据库连接失败、数据查询速度慢等。通过观察现象、分析日志等方式来确定问题。
-
收集信息:收集相关的信息,包括数据库版本、操作系统版本、错误日志等。这些信息有助于后续的问题分析和解决。
-
分析原因:根据收集到的信息,结合数据库的原理和技术知识,进行问题分析。可以借助数据库的监控工具、性能分析工具等来辅助分析。
-
解决问题:根据问题的具体情况,采取相应的解决方法。可以是调整数据库配置参数、优化查询语句、增加硬件资源等。在解决问题的过程中,需要进行测试和验证,确保问题得到彻底解决。
二、常见数据库疑问及解决方法:
- 数据库连接失败:
- 检查数据库服务是否正常启动;
- 检查网络连接是否正常;
- 检查数据库账号和密码是否正确;
- 检查数据库防火墙设置是否阻止了连接。
- 数据库性能问题:
- 检查数据库服务器的硬件资源是否足够;
- 分析慢查询日志,优化查询语句;
- 增加索引来提高查询性能;
- 调整数据库的缓冲区大小、并发连接数等参数。
- 数据丢失问题:
- 检查数据库备份是否正常,恢复备份数据;
- 检查数据库日志,找出数据丢失的原因;
- 调整数据库的事务隔离级别,确保数据的一致性。
- 数据库安全问题:
- 设置数据库账号和密码的复杂度要求;
- 定期更新数据库软件和补丁;
- 控制数据库的访问权限,只允许授权用户访问;
- 定期备份数据库,以防止数据丢失。
- 数据库扩容问题:
- 添加更多的硬件资源,例如增加硬盘容量、内存等;
- 使用数据库集群来实现水平扩展;
- 对数据库进行分区和分表,提高数据库的并发能力。
总结:
解决数据库疑问需要掌握数据库的基本原理和技术,并且具备一定的问题排查和解决能力。在实际操作中,可以根据具体的问题采取相应的解决方法,同时也要注意数据库的安全性和稳定性。为了提高数据库的性能和可用性,建议定期进行数据库的维护和优化工作。1年前 -